Philadelphia Style Magazine:

Carol Morgan does not classify Carol Morgan, LLC as a dating service. "I am a matchmaker in the old-fashioned, traditional sense," she says.

 


The matchmaker began in 1988, after her mother passed away and she matched up her 66-year-old father. "My clients are the type of people that would not go to clubs or bars. These individuals are looking for an elegant source of social introduction."

Morgan says that 75 percent of her clients find her via word of mouth. While her database of eligible singles is large, she works with about 200 individuals at any given time. If her database does not contain a match that she feels would please her client, Carol will actually search for them through a myriad of sources.

 



Main Line Today Magazine:

Don't make the mistake of telling Carol Morgan that she's in the dating business. She'll not spare a second correcting you.


"I am a new-age matchmaker," says Morgan, owner of Carol Morgan LLC. The upscale, well-educated professionals who seek Morgan's expertise call her business the "undating service" because they want to get out of the dating game and into a life partnership.

Morgan interviews each of her prospective clients carefully and thoroughly. "The whole process is very relaxed and civilized. And a lot of fun," says Morgan, who was a soap opera actress in a former life. And how successful has Morgan been in her 15 years of matching people up? "Very," she says beaming.

Philadelphia Magazine: "Changing Careers"

Act I: Commodities broker. Twenty years ago, when people were minting money by investing in gold, Morgan was flying high in New York and San Francisco as a commodities broker in precious metals. When the market plunged, conscience forced her to tell her clients to take their profits fast.


"I believe that bulls and bears make money, but pigs get slaughtered. I didn't want to see my clients slaughtered," she says. Her sage advice left her with lots of friends but no customers.

Act II: Matchmaker. Morgan's mother died in 1988, leaving her father inconsolably lonely. Thinking that dating might lift his spirits, Morgan created a personal ad for him that drew more than 100 responses. Morgan's experience inspired her to start a hands-on matchmaking service for others. Today, her company Carol Morgan LLC makes introductions for a select, high-end clientele. She has many weddings to her credit and is about to go national.
